What is a specimen driver?

Specimen Drivers are professionals responsible for transporting biological samples, such as blood, urine, or tissue specimens, between medical facilities, laboratories, and clinics. Their work ensures that these samples are delivered in a timely and secure manner, following strict protocols to maintain specimen integrity and comply with health regulations. Specimen Drivers often use specialized containers and may need to document chain-of-custody procedures. This role is vital for supporting diagnostic testing and patient care by ensuring samples reach labs quickly and safely.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a specimen driver,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Specimen Driver, you need a valid driver's license, a clean driving record, and strong attention to detail for handling and transporting medical specimens safely. Familiarity with GPS navigation systems, route planning software, and basic specimen handling protocols or certifications like OSHA training are commonly required. Reliability, time management, and professionalism are crucial soft skills for maintaining schedules and ensuring secure deliveries. These skills are essential to ensure timely, accurate delivery of specimens and uphold the integrity of medical testing processes.

What are some common challenges faced by specimen drivers, and how can they be overcome?

Specimen Drivers often face challenges such as managing tight delivery schedules, maintaining specimen integrity during transport, and navigating traffic or weather-related delays. These challenges can be overcome by following established protocols for specimen handling, using GPS and route optimization tools, and maintaining clear communication with laboratory staff. Attention to detail, time management, and adaptability are key to ensuring specimens are delivered promptly and safely, which is essential for accurate laboratory testing.

What is the difference between Specimen Driver vs Medical Courier?

AspectSpecimen DriverMedical Courier
CredentialsDriver's license, possibly medical trainingDriver's license, often specialized training
Work EnvironmentHospitals, laboratories, clinicsMedical facilities, labs, pharmacies
Industry UsageHealthcare, diagnostic labsHealthcare, pharmaceutical delivery
Common Search IntentSpecimen Driver vs Medical Courier

Both Specimen Drivers and Medical Couriers transport medical items, but Specimen Drivers typically focus on delivering biological samples to labs, often requiring specific handling procedures. Medical Couriers have a broader scope, including pharmaceuticals and medical equipment. While their roles overlap, Specimen Drivers usually work more closely with diagnostic labs, emphasizing sample integrity and safety.

How to become a specimen driver?

To become a specimen driver, candidates typically need a valid driver's license, a clean driving record, and good knowledge of local routes. Some employers may require a background check, training on handling biological specimens, and adherence to safety protocols. Prior experience in delivery or courier services can be beneficial.
